The 180-degree rule says you should draw a line through your scene, and the cameras should only be on one side of that line. Crossing the line can be disorienting for the audience, because everything is facing the opposite direction. But as Fede Alvarez points out, those are helpful guidelines, not rules to be boxed in by.
